Differentiation
Content:
Content is what we want
student to learn or how the
student will get access to the
information

Process:
It is how students come to
understand or make sense
of the content.

Product:
How learning is assessed?
How you expect the students

Utilize diagnostic & pre-tests to assess where


individual students need to begin study of a given
topic or unit.
Encourage thinking at various levels of Bloom's
taxonomy.
Use a variety of instructional delivery methods (e.g
interactive board, Socrative , Edmodo, jigsaw
,RAFTetc) to address different learning styles.
[e.g video or audio notes(Youtube) for students
who learn better with repeated listening]
Break assignments into smaller, more manageable
parts that include structured directions for each
part.
Choose broad instructional concepts and skills that
lend themselves to understanding at various levels
of complexity.
Develop activities that target auditory, visual, and
kinesthetic learners.
Provide access to a variety of materials which
target different learning preferences and reading
abilities.
Establish stations for inquiry-based, independent
learning activities.
Create activities that vary in level of complexity
and degree of abstract thinking required. e.g.
THINK TAC TOE: Complete a row, column or
diagonal line of activities./ OR Choice Menus
Use flexible grouping to group and regroup
students based on factors including content, ability,
and assessment results.
Use a variety of assessment strategies (Formative
assessment tools e.g. Frayers Model, Rubrics,
